Ultragenyx Pharmaceutical Inc. (RARE) closed at $23.14, down 1.07% on the session. The stock is trading between established support at $21.98 and resistance near $24.30, with recent price action reflecting ongoing sector‑wide caution.

The modest decline in RARE shares occurred on what appeared to be normal trading volume, consistent with the broader biotech sector’s recent subdued activity. While no company‑specific news catalyzed the move, pharmaceutical and biotechnology stocks have been sensitive to macroeconomic factors such as interest rate expectations and risk‑off sentiment. Ultragenyx, a clinical‑stage biopharmaceutical company focused on rare diseases, continues to attract attention for its pipeline of gene therapy and enzyme‑replacement candidates. However, investors remain cautious ahead of key clinical readouts and regulatory milestones. The company’s valuation often hinges on trial results, and the current pullback may reflect profit‑taking after a period of relative stability. Sector‑wide, small‑cap biotech names have experienced heightened volatility this quarter, and RARE’s price action is consistent with this trend. The $21.98 support level, which corresponds to a prior swing low, has held on several tests and could provide a floor for the stock. Conversely, resistance at $24.30 has capped upside attempts in recent weeks, creating a defined zone of price congestion.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) appears to be in the low‑to‑mid 30s, suggesting momentum is weak but not yet oversold. Price action shows a series of lower highs since late last year, indicating a gradual downtrend. The stock is trading below its 50‑day moving average, which is now sloping lower — a bearish signal in the medium term. However, the distance from the 50‑day average is relatively narrow, leaving room for a potential bounce if buying interest returns. Volume patterns have been relatively consistent, with no abnormal spikes to suggest distribution. Looking ahead, RARE’s trajectory may hinge on several factors. A breakdown below $21.98 could open the door to further declines, with the next potential support zone near the $20 level. Conversely, a sustained move above $24.30 would signal renewed bullish momentum and could target the next resistance around $26. Upcoming catalysts include updates from ongoing clinical trials, particularly for the company’s gene therapy for Angelman syndrome and its enzyme‑replacement therapy for hypophosphatasia. Positive data could drive a re‑rating, while delays or setbacks may pressure shares. Broader market sentiment in the biotechnology sector — including trends in financing and FDA approvals — could also influence price. Investors may watch for volume confirmation on any breakouts or breakdowns to gauge conviction. Given the uncertain clinical development timeline, the stock may remain range‑bound in the near term.
